#417fca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#417fca is composed of 25.5% red, 49.8% green and 79.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 67.8% cyan, 37.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 20.8% black. It has a hue angle of 212.8 degrees, a saturation of 56.4% and a lightness of 52.4%. #417fca color hex could be obtained by blending #82feff with #000095. Closest websafe color is: #3366cc.

Shades and Tints of #417fca

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030609 is the darkest color, while #f9fbfd is the lightest one.

Tones of #417fca

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#828589 is the less saturated color, while #127bf9 is the most saturated one.
